Output ab62e52a41a2bbd6802c3dbc9e0b5dd913667e55603bb954dbc68f7bfe7a725a:84

value
21686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85ccd9974f688452471e93d8449fd7773e2b582dd80e6b851896e23a2989a22d
address
bc1pshxdn960dzz9y3c7j0vyf87hwulzkkpdmq8xhpgcjm3r52vf5gks7adq56
transaction
ab62e52a41a2bbd6802c3dbc9e0b5dd913667e55603bb954dbc68f7bfe7a725a
spent
true